The wait was not worth it in my opinion. The service was amazing but the food, which is the main reason to go to any restaurant wasn't to the other best ramen places I've been. There's no options of different types of noodles. Unfortunately they use prepackaged noodles like Ichiban or similar and that doesn't cut it. The broth was okay and so were the toppings. I do have to give them credit with the cuts of pork, which were fresh and high quality. If there's no line up, I would probably go again. But if there is a line, don't buy into the hype.

Food was amazing!! The area Mensho is located in is not the best just a heads up since there is a line you have to wait in. It took about 40 minutes for us to get seated. The Vegan Tantanmen was a heavy favorite of mine, loved the creaminess and all crunch of various items instead. The vegan GKO definitely was more spicy but also was very good!! Due to the spiciness though, it was harder to munch down still great though. The seasoning on the corn ribs was AMAZING. Would go back just for those haha

Great tiny space for authentic ramen. I came alone and revive my experience in Asia. Spicy Enoki Chips were crunchy, tasty, chewy, nice touch of the chili oil and lemon. Pretty good size. G.K.O. Was great size, very creamy and rich in flavor, not that very spicy but I'm Mexican, who knows how spicy it really was. The flavor of garlic was intense, the combination of the chashu with the Fried carrot was my favourite part. Drank a Choya Plum wine to dive into the whole experience.
